About Lee Davis Jr.

Hello, and nice to meet you. My name is Lee, and this is where I tell you a bit about myself.

I am a father, a grandfather (hard to believe, I know), a son, a brother, and a playful, energetic, loyal husband to my best friend, D’Yan. I was born and raised in Florida and have traveled a fair bit, including nearly two years living in Afghanistan. I am happiest where the ocean is blue and the sun is bright, especially in the Caribbean or the Mediterranean. I choose to navigate life with empathy and kindness. Give it a try and watch your world flourish.

When I am not crafting stories, you will find me strolling the sandy streets of New Smyrna Beach, finding solace by the ocean, basking in the sun, spending time with family, losing myself in books, exploring our fascinating world, or diving into research rabbit holes that eventually surface in my fiction.

I am a bit of a hedonist and pursue pleasure without apology. I am drawn to the thin line where rational thought meets primal impulse and where the mind becomes both sanctuary and saboteur on the journey toward becoming our whole selves.

We only live once. I would rather dare and fail than regret not trying.

My stories explore the crossroads of crisis, the moments when ordinary people face extraordinary circumstances and discover their true nature. I write narratives where emotional authenticity meets pulse-quickening tension, shaped by my fascination with culture, human resilience, and the subtle currents that influence our choices.

At the heart of each tale stands the character, complex individuals whose journeys are forged in the fires of raw emotion, unwavering loyalty, and quiet courage.
